About Glen Cove Center For Nursing And Rehabilitation

Glen Cove Center For Nursing And Rehabilitation is a skilled nursing / long term care community in Glen Cove, New York. The community is licensed for up to 154 residents.

Families rate Glen Cove Center For Nursing And Rehabilitation 4.1 out of 5 based on 208 Google reviews.

Dee Russo

Mar 2026

via Google

Just left Glen cove Rehab Center a few days ago. Lots of problems at this facility. Food pretty awful. Served cold most days and often given high carb meals, even though I’m diabetic. The rooms and bathrooms were old and dingy! The daytime aides, for the most part, were decent, but the night time aides, not so much. The wait times for them to answer the call bells just to use the bathroom, was out of control. Tiki, the facility clerk was a ray of sunshine, anlways willing to help in anny way she could. Anna from housekeeping was so pleasant and helpful towards the patients. My physical therapy team, Amanda and EJ were kind and caring. I was in a lot of pain, but they inspired and encouraged me to do the PT. On the other hand, Andrew the head of PT, did not know how to speak to people and spoke to me like a child being scolded! The best people there were the nursing team! They were overworked, understaffed and unappreciated! Ennis, Alex and Julia were exceptional, so dedicated and on top of their game! They did not walk out of your room and just forget about you! They followed through with the task at hand every time! They all had the perfect blend of being hard workers, compassionate and empathetic. If not for them, I would never have been able “to do my time” in that facility! Melissa, a night time nurse, was kind and caring too. Again, my kudos goes to the nursing staff. They bear the brunt of the burden of each day, with very little recognition! Some serious changes need to happen at this facility, because as of right now, they are headed in one direction, a downward spiral!

Government Inspection History

3 inspection visits in the last three years, 19 citations on file. Inspections are conducted by state agencies on behalf of the U.S.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S).

Dec 18, 2025Fire Safety StandardHealth Standard6 citations
  • Ensure food and drink is palatable, attractive, and at a safe and appetizing temperature.

    Severity F of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, widespreadCorrected Feb 9, 2026

  • Have elevators that firefighters can control in the event of a fire.

    Severity E of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, patternCorrected Feb 3, 2026

  • Have a battery powered remote alarm panel in a location accessible by operating personnel.

    Severity D of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, isolatedCorrected Dec 22, 2025

  • Provide and implement an infection prevention and control program.

    Severity D of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, isolatedCorrected Feb 9, 2026

  • Honor the resident's right to a safe, clean, comfortable and homelike environment, including but not limited to receiving treatment and supports for daily living safely.

    Severity D of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, isolatedCorrected Feb 9, 2026

  • Procure food from sources approved or considered satisfactory and store, prepare, distribute and serve food in accordance with professional standards.

    Severity D of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, isolatedCorrected Feb 9, 2026
